Nik Laufer Edel
About Nik Laufer Edel
Nik Laufer Edel is a Product Lead currently working at A.Team and Tribe AI, with a background in product management and user experience research. He has over 15 years of experience in the Edtech sector and has held various roles at companies such as Woebot Health, Lyft, and Udemy.

Previous Experience in Product Management
Nik Laufer Edel has a diverse background in product management, having worked at several organizations. He was a Principal Product Manager at Woebot Health from 2020 to 2021, where he contributed to the development of a prescription digital therapeutic via an AI chatbot. Prior to that, he served as a Product Manager at Lyft from 2016 to 2020, and as a Senior Product Manager at Udemy from 2014 to 2016.
Educational Background
Nik Laufer Edel has a solid educational foundation in business and marketing. He studied at The University of British Columbia, earning a Bachelor of Commerce in Marketing from 2003 to 2008. He also attended the University of Victoria, where he focused on Entrepreneurship, and studied at the University of Cologne and WU Vienna, achieving degrees in Business and German.
